if(${CMAKE_CXX_COMPILER_ID} STREQUAL "GNU"
		AND (${CMAKE_CXX_COMPILER_VERSION} VERSION_LESS "9"
			OR (CMAKE_SIZE_OF_VOID_P EQUAL 4
				OR (${CMAKE_SYSTEM_PROCESSOR} STREQUAL "arm")))) # TODO: implict definition of A_PLATFORM
endif()

if((((${CMAKE_CXX_COMPILER_ID}) STREQUAL "GNU"
				AND ${CMAKE_CXX_COMPILER_VERSION} VERSION_LESS "9")
			OR CMAKE_SIZE_OF_VOID_P EQUAL 4)
		OR ${CMAKE_SYSTEM_PROCESSOR} STREQUAL "arm") # TODO: implict definition of A_PLATFORM
endif()

if(${CMAKE_CXX_COMPILER_ID} STREQUAL "GNU"
		AND (${CMAKE_CXX_COMPILER_VERSION} VERSION_LESS "9"
			OR CMAKE_SIZE_OF_VOID_P EQUAL 4)
		OR ${CMAKE_SYSTEM_PROCESSOR} STREQUAL "arm")
endif()
